Jack’s Basket is a 501(c)3 nonprofit organization with a mission to celebrate babies with Down syndrome. We strive to ensure that every new and expectant parent is provided resources and avenues of support within the community. We aim to equip medical providers with tools to discuss the diagnosis in an unbiased way in hopes that having a baby with Down syndrome is celebrated like any other. We support families from the time of diagnosis to the baby’s 1st birthday. We do this by focusing on three primary activities: Engaging and equipping medical providers with tools to communicate and discuss Down syndrome accurately without bias. Connecting new parents with other families and resources through our basket delivery program. Sharing powerful stories to change the narrative around Down syndrome. Jack’s Basket is committed to celebrating babies with Down syndrome by impacting how their stories begin. We are here to equip you with the tools and resources you need to deliver a Down syndrome diagnosis in an accurate, empathic, and unbiased way, in hopes that families will be encouraged to celebrate their pregnancy and their baby like any other. As a part of our mission we: Equip providers with tools to communicate the diagnosis accurately without bias through provider-to-provider training, medical modules, and peer-reviewed journal publications. Encourage providers to recognize the critical role they play in a family’s story and to reshape these discussions from “breaking bad news” to “sharing unexpected news. Reframe the narrative around Down syndrome by sharing stories of families who overwhelmingly come to view their child’s diagnosis with positivity and optimism, even after experiencing shock or grief when first learning of the diagnosis.
